FCC Form 314 and the applicable exhibits/explanations are required to be filed when applying for consent for assignment of an AM, FM or TV broadcast station construction permit or license. On June 2, 2003, the FCC released a Report and Order and NPRM, MB Docket No. 02-277 et al., 18 FCC Rcd 13620 (2003). On September 3, 2003, the Court granted a motion to stay the new broadcast ownership rules. On September 3, 2004, the Court issued an order granting the petition for panel rehearing ("Rehearing Order"), allowing the new radio ownership rules to go into effect, thus partially lifting the stay.
